Compounds of the invention are of the formula (I); wherein: is a double bond and X is C; or is a single bond and X is N, CH or CQR1; and wherein: n is 1 to 10; R is H or QR1; each R′ is independently selected from H and QR1; each Q is independently selected from a bond, CO, NH, S, SO, SO2 or O; each R1 is independently selected from C1-C10 alkyl, C2-C10 alkenyl, C2-C10 alkynyl, substituted or unsubstituted aryl or heteroaryl, acyl, C1-C10 cycloalkyl, halogen, C1-C10 alkylaryl or C1-C10 heterocycloalkyl; L is a nitrogen-containing heteroaryl; and W is a zinc-chelating residue; or a pharmaceutically acceptable salt thereof. The compounds are useful in therapy.
